Sudarshana is a Postdoctoral Associate at Steinschneider Research Group. She earned her Ph.D. in Spring 2020 from the Department of Civil, Construction and Environmental Engineering at NCSU.  She worked as a Graduate Research Assistant in the Climate, Hydrology and Water Resources: Modeling and Synthesis Group with Dr. Sankar Arumugam.

Sudarshana’s primary research area is statistical hydrology with an emphasis on stochastic hydrological modeling that aims at efficiently using climate information in water resources management. She is interested in river-basin scale multi-reservoir modeling for understanding water-energy nexus using probabilistic hydroclimatological forecasts and identifying the drivers of hydroclimatic variability across different spatial and temporal scale.
